Haryana’s Sain Packaging installs brand new Heidelberg Speedmaster CS 92-5+L

924

Sain Packaging, a leading pharma-packaging company based out of Sonepat in Haryana, has upgraded its state-of-the-art production facility with the installation of a brand new Heidelberg Speedmaster CS 92 5-colour press with inline coater. The company adopts the high-end Heidelberg press mainly to enhance its overall print quality, wastage as well as meeting on-time deliveries.

Designed for high productivity and shorter make-readies, the unique 37’’ format Heidelberg Speedmaster CS 92 generates 20 percent plate savings vs traditional 40’’ equipment – a key competitive differentiation.

“We specialise in pharma packaging that constitutes more than 90 percent of present business. The CS 92 is an ideal fit into our modus operandi, thanks to its 25 X 37 inch format that will help optimize waste management. With the CS 92, we expect to save around INR 1.5 lakhs in plate costs,” adds Sachin.

Equipped with printing speeds of up to 15,000 sheets per hour, the CS 92 handles a broad spectrum of print substrates with thickness varying between 0.03 mm and 0.6 mm (0.0012 inches to 0.024 inches). In addition to the classic 16-page A4 format, the Speedmaster CS 92 allows for the use of additional imposition layouts – Nine A4 repeats or 6-page products in three rows of repeats.

Recalling the early days of Sain Packaging, Sachin says that the company started its journey in 2004 as a small printing firm operated with a small production plant located in Burari village, north Delhi. The plant was barely equipped with a single-colour press and a used double-colour Heidelberg press added later on in a few months. “From time to time we never stop expanding our machine line as well as client base,” mentions Sachin, adding that current machine portfolio of the company consists of three 5-colour sheefed offset presses with coater, one 4-colour offset press and four 2-colour presses.

Heidelberg’s proprietary and award-winning Intellistart technology significantly shortens make-ready times for the Speedmaster CS 92, saving up to 70 percent of operational steps. The Ink fountain liners on the CS 92 ensure zero calibration at every ink key, which supports precise automatic color adjustment. Parallel wash programs monitored by the Ink fountain sensor further shorten make-ready times.

“The quicker make-readies greatly enhance our ability to promptly meet delivery timelines,” agrees Sachin, before adding, “Fully-automated sheet arrival and alignment ensure non-stop production with the CS 92, while feeder and delivery units are designed to handle higher piles of up to 1.3 meters. This reduces print interruptions arising from pile change – clearly a win-win.”

With a rapidly-evolving customer base in Amritsar, Baddi, Roorkee, and other cities, Sain Packaging runs a 65,000 sq ft production facility with 250 employees, converting nearly 400 tonnes of boards every month.
